
If you always wish for more, you will never know the peace and satisfaction of having enough.
Realizing that you already have enough is one of the most profoundly empowering thoughts you can have.
Fully enjoying the first piece of cake does not prevent you from having a second.
Yet obsessing over whether or not you'll get another piece will always prevent you from enjoying what you have.
Being satisfied does not mean you must be complacent.
Being satisfied enables you to draw strength from your desires instead of letting them enslave you.
